Real estate has long been recognized as a sound investment vehicle. Whether you're aiming to build wealth, generate passive income, or simply diversify your portfolio, the real estate market offers numerous options. From residential properties to retail spaces, there's a segment of the market to suit individual investor's aspirations.
It's important to perform thorough due diligence before diving into any real estate investment.
Consider factors such as location, market trends, property condition, and financing options. Moreover, it's prudent to engage with experienced professionals, including real estate agents, attorneys, and financial advisors.
They can provide invaluable insights and guidance more info to help you traverse the complexities of the real estate market and enhance your investment potential.
Navigating the Home Buying Process with Confidence
Buying a home is an thrilling milestone, but it can also be a complex process. To navigate this journey with steadfastness, it's crucial to understand with the steps involved and arm yourself with the right knowledge. Start with researching your monetary standing. Determine how much you can comfortably spend, and get pre-approved for a mortgage to bolster your buying power. Next collaborate with a reputable real estate agent who can advise you through the procedure.
They'll help you in finding appropriate properties that meet your requirements, and wrestle on your behalf to secure the best possible deal. During the process, don't falter to inquire for understanding on anything you find confusing.
Remember, buying a home is a significant commitment, so take your time, do your due diligence, and make strategic selections. By adhering to these tips, you can navigate the home buying process with confidence.

Residential vs. Commercial Real Estate: Discovering Your Niche
Venturing into the realm of real estate can be an exciting opportunity, but with two distinct paths—residential and commercial—choosing the right niche is crucial for success. Residential real estate involves selling properties designed for habitation, catering to individuals and families seeking their dream homes. In contrast, business real estate focuses on properties used for revenue-producing purposes, such as offices, retail spaces, or industrial facilities. Understanding the requirements of each market segment and your personal skills is key to exploring this dynamic industry.

Strength of Location: A Key Factor in Real Estate Success
When jumping into the property market, location is arguably the most crucial factor. The desirability of a property is directly affected by its setting. Buyers are always seeking out properties in prime neighborhoods that provide ease of use to amenities, transportation, and leisure activities. A property's location can significantly impact its resale value over time.
Real Estate Trends: What's Hot and What's Not?
The real estate market is in a constant state of flux, with trends changing rapidly. Buyers and sellers alike need to stay ahead of the curve to make informed decisions. One trend that’s undeniably popular is the demand for eco-friendly homes. As environmental awareness grows, more people are seeking properties that minimize their impact on the planet.
Smart home features are also becoming increasingly in demand. Buyers are open to pay a premium for homes with cutting-edge features that offer convenience, security, and energy efficiency.
On the other hand, some trends are losing momentum. Open concept floor plans, while once trendy, are starting to fade in appeal as buyers value more defined spaces for privacy and purpose.
Similarly, spacious homes that were coveted just a few years ago are facing pressure from smaller, more minimalist options. As urban populations grow, the demand of townhouses is rising.
